f
This commit is contained in:
@@ -26,10 +26,10 @@ ARG COMMIT=dev
|
|||||||
ARG BUILD_TIME
|
ARG BUILD_TIME
|
||||||
RUN BUILD_TIME=${BUILD_TIME:-$(date -u +"%Y-%m-%dT%H:%M:%SZ")} && \
|
RUN BUILD_TIME=${BUILD_TIME:-$(date -u +"%Y-%m-%dT%H:%M:%SZ")} && \
|
||||||
CGO_ENABLED=0 GOOS=linux GOARCH=amd64 go build \
|
CGO_ENABLED=0 GOOS=linux GOARCH=amd64 go build \
|
||||||
-ldflags "-X main.version=${VERSION} -X main.commit=${COMMIT} -X main.date=${BUILD_TIME} -w -s" \
|
-ldflags "-X main.version=${VERSION} -X main.commit=${COMMIT} -X main.date=$$BUILD_TIME -w -s" \
|
||||||
-a -installsuffix cgo \
|
-a -installsuffix cgo \
|
||||||
-o hyapi-server \
|
-o hyapi-server \
|
||||||
cmd/api/main.go
|
./cmd/api
|
||||||
|
|
||||||
# 第二阶段:运行阶段
|
# 第二阶段:运行阶段
|
||||||
FROM alpine:3.19
|
FROM alpine:3.19
|
||||||
|
|||||||
@@ -26,10 +26,10 @@ ARG COMMIT=dev
|
|||||||
ARG BUILD_TIME
|
ARG BUILD_TIME
|
||||||
RUN BUILD_TIME=${BUILD_TIME:-$(date -u +"%Y-%m-%dT%H:%M:%SZ")} && \
|
RUN BUILD_TIME=${BUILD_TIME:-$(date -u +"%Y-%m-%dT%H:%M:%SZ")} && \
|
||||||
CGO_ENABLED=0 GOOS=linux GOARCH=amd64 go build \
|
CGO_ENABLED=0 GOOS=linux GOARCH=amd64 go build \
|
||||||
-ldflags "-X main.version=${VERSION} -X main.commit=${COMMIT} -X main.date=${BUILD_TIME} -w -s" \
|
-ldflags "-X main.version=${VERSION} -X main.commit=${COMMIT} -X main.date=$$BUILD_TIME -w -s" \
|
||||||
-a -installsuffix cgo \
|
-a -installsuffix cgo \
|
||||||
-o worker \
|
-o worker \
|
||||||
cmd/worker/main.go
|
./cmd/worker
|
||||||
|
|
||||||
# 第二阶段:运行阶段
|
# 第二阶段:运行阶段
|
||||||
FROM alpine:3.19
|
FROM alpine:3.19
|
||||||
|
|||||||
Reference in New Issue
Block a user